Dishes
Nanru Spicy Chicken Wing BonesChicken wing bones marinated with fermented soybean paste, chili, garlic, then fried or pan-seared, resulting in a crispy, spicy, and savory flavor with rich umami depth.
Nanru Honey Glazed Chicken FramesFresh chicken frames marinated in a secret sauce of fermented tofu and honey, then grilled to perfection—crispy outside, tender and juicy inside.
Authentic Fish Cake with FillingFresh fish meat mixed with scallions, ginger, egg white, and starch forms a paste, wrapped around shrimp or pork filling, then steamed to create a tender, chewy texture with layered flavor.
Signature Nánrǔ Chicken ThighA premium chicken thigh dish marinated in fermented black bean sauce, then slow-cooked to tender perfection with rich savory flavor.
Cantonese Fried Tofu with LeeksChao-Shan leek fried tofu is made by cutting tofu into cubes, coating them lightly with starch, frying until golden and crispy, then stir-frying with chopped leeks. A touch of salt and soy sauce enhances the tender inside and fresh aroma of the leeks.
